In the digital world, things change almost daily. Google keeps updating its algorithm and newer technology like voice search changes how people find your business. Today’s websites need to be super- fast, mobile-friendly, user-friendly, fully-optimized, and content-heavy. Your site also needs to look good. Just as clothing styles change, so does website design. How well is your site meeting these challenges? We recommend that you go through our Website Redesign Checklist and see if your site could benefit from an update.

Website Redesign Checklist

We break the redesign process down into three stages.

  1. Discovery and Planning
  2. Design and Development
  3. Content and Marketing

Website Redesign Checklist: Discovery and Planning

First, you need to know how well your site performs under the hood. The best way to find loading problems is to use the Pingdom Website Speed Test. Their analysis is free and shows you if your website is running slow,

The second thing you need to check is if your site is mobile-friendly. Speed and how your site performs on mobile have become crucial to how you rank on Google. One way to determine if your website needs to be more mobile-friendly is through the use of Google’s Mobile-Friendly Test.

Another thing you should think about is integration. Do you have mailing lists set up to collect leads? What about contact forms and automated responses? Is your site integrated with your social media? All these components should work together as if they were part of the same body.

After giving careful consideration to how well your site functions, it is time to look at the goals for your site.

  • What part does your website play in your overall business model?
  • Who are your primary clients? Your secondary clients?
  • What are the stages of their buyer journey?
  • Are there niche markets you wish to explore?
  • Do you have offline marketing to complement your online marketing?
  • Have you determined your unique value proposition?

Once you know what your goals are, then you can move to the next Stage of Your Website Redesign.

Website Redesign Checklist: Design and Development

Everyone knows when it is time to update a kitchen or a living room. Usually, the shag carpet, wallpaper, and avocado appliances are key indicators that you need to redecorate. The same applies to your website. Keep it current and fresh. Make sure your images don’t look dated, and your content is evergreen. Check your links. Are they still valid?

What about the overall design? Do you like the colors? The font? Have you considered adding a video or a scrolling overlay to your homepage? Look around the web and find website layouts that appeal to you. Then, evaluate them in regards to what you clients would like. Once you have ideas in mind, you can share them with your web designer. Once you’ve decided on a web design, then it’s time to update the code. If you think of the web design as the face, then the code is the brain inside. Updated programming increases functionality and also creates the beautiful web pages your client’s see.

Website Redesign Checklist: Content and Marketing

A site falls into one of two categories. It is where you do business, or it promotes your company. Either way, marketing your website is crucial for it to be effective.

The goal of marketing is exposure. You want to reach as many potential clients as possible. That means you need to rank high in the search results.

Adding content to your website is one of the primary ways to improve your Google rank. SEO strategies drive traffic and improve the user experience. If you don’t have a blog, then that should be one of the main components of a website redesign.

A website redesign should also include landing page optimization and local optimization.
